Jettison plan to concession NIOMCO, community tells FG

THE Udu Traditional Council, the apex traditional authority of the Udu people of Delta State, has advised the Federal Government to jettision the idea of concessioning the Nigeria Iron Ore Mines Company, NIOMCO, to Global Steel Holdings Limited which it accused of being a failed firm.

Forex concessions for pilgrimages

The directive by the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) for the Pilgrims Travel Allowance (PTA) to be sold to intending pilgrims at N197 to $1 has, understandably drawn sharp criticisms, coming at a time that factories cannot get enough foreign exchange to import crucial inputs and parents are finding it difficult to pay the school bills of their children studying abroad due to the scarcity and high cost of foreign exchange.

Countries scramble to sign Toriola as coach

The rapturous applause that greeted his exit from the Table Tennis event of the Rio Olympics could have been mistaken for a victorious ovation. Nigeria’s legendary table tennis icon Segun Toriola exited the Games on Sunday but held his head high the way only legends do.

OPEC predicts rise in crude oil price next month

THE Organisation of Petroleum Exporting Countries, OPEC, yesterday said it was confident that the prices of crude oil would rise by next month as against the current low prices at the International market.
